I am pleased to advise that I have secured funding to install a new bike jump track in Salisbury Recreation Reserve. The bike jump track will cater to beginner, intermediate and expert BMX riders and is positioned in an area away from homes, but visible from Evans Road.
The bike jump track has come after I was contacted by a number of young BMX riders and their parents. I have involved them in the development of the design, along with Council and bike track experts.
Residents are invited to an information session Thursday 12 September from 4-5pm to discuss the new bike jump track in the Salisbury Recreational Reserve (near the cricket nets). This is your opportunity to ask any questions about the proposed design and I welcome your feedback.
